GOODY'S COOL ORANGE 500


The 'Goody's Cool Orange 500' is a NASCAR Nextel Cup stock car race held at the Martinsville Speedway in Martinsville, Virginia.
Long time sponsor Goody's returned as race sponsor for the 2007 spring race with their new orange-flavored brand with the race title being Goody's Cool Orange 500; the Goody's 500 was originally the name of the fall race, which is now the Subway 500.
The race was run on April 1, 2007. It was the second race for NASCAR's new car design, the Car of Tomorrow.

Past winners



★ 2007 Jimmie Johnson (first COT win at Martinsville)-

★ 2006 Tony Stewart

★ 2005 Jeff Gordon

★ 2004 Rusty Wallace

★ 2003 Jeff Gordon

★ 2002 Bobby Labonte

★ 2001 Dale Jarrett

★ 2000 Mark Martin

★ 1999 John Andretti

★ 1998 Bobby Hamilton

★ 1997 Jeff Gordon

★ 1996 Rusty Wallace

★ 1995 Rusty Wallace (356 laps due to rain)

★ 1994 Rusty Wallace

★ 1993 Rusty Wallace

★ 1992 Mark Martin

★ 1991 Dale Earnhardt

★ 1990 Geoffrey Bodine

★ 1989 Darrell Waltrip

★ 1988 Dale Earnhardt

★ 1987 Dale Earnhardt

★ 1986 Ricky Rudd

★ 1985 Harry Gant

★ 1984 Geoffrey Bodine

★ 1983 Darrell Waltrip

★ 1982 Harry Gant

★ 1981 Morgan Shepherd

★ 1980 Darrell Waltrip

★ 1979 Richard Petty

★ 1978 Darrell Waltrip

★ 1977 Cale Yarborough (384 laps due to rain)

★ 1976 Darrell Waltrip

★ 1975 Richard Petty

★ 1974 Cale Yarborough

★ 1973 David Pearson

★ 1972 Richard Petty

★ 1971 Richard Petty

★ 1970 Bobby Isaac (376 laps)

★ 1969 Richard Petty

★ 1968 Cale Yarborough

★ 1967 Richard Petty

★ 1966 Jim Paschal

★ 1965 Fred Lorenzen

★ 1964 Fred Lorenzen

★ 1963 Richard Petty

★ 1962 Richard Petty

★ 1961 Junior Johnson

★ 1960 Richard Petty

★ 1959 Lee Petty

★ 1958 Bob Welborn

★ 1957 Buck Baker

★ 1956 Buck Baker

★ 1955 Tim Flock

★ 1954 Jim Paschal

★ 1953 Lee Petty

★ 1952 Dick Rathmann

★ 1951 Curtis Turner

★ 1950 Curtis Turner

★ 1949 Red Byron
